What does banana republic classic green smell like?

Banana Republic Classic Green Perfume by Banana Republic, Banana Republic Classic Green is a citrus green floral fragrance for women, inspired by the crisp scent of a freshly-laundered white cotton shirt. The top notes of basil, ginger and petitgrain dance together in a bright, energizing herbal concoction.

What does modern by Banana Republic smell like?

The fragrance introduces top notes of Sparkling Watery Accord, Red Seaweed, Juniper and Grapefruit. The heart adds scents of Japanese Radish, White Cyclamen and Tamarind, while the base closes with intense aromas of Rain Forest Patchouli, Solar Musk, Vetiver, White Birch and Incense.

Is Banana Republic cruelty free?

Banana Republic has a basic formal policy to protect animal welfare, and it doesn’t use fur, angora, down, or exotic animal skin. But it still uses leather, wool, and exotic animal hair, and we found no evidence the brand traces any animal products to the first stage of production.

What does banana republic gardenia and cardamom smell like?

Product Description. Gardenia & Cardamom is a white floral scent with top notes of juicy mandarin and sultry gardenia, a heart of tuberose and nutty cardamom, and a dry down of driftwood and warm amber.

Which is better Cyprus or cedar?

Old-growth cypress is rated as being very durable — more durable than cedar — but it’s hard to find and expensive. Younger cypress is rated as moderately durable. Cedar has a pleasant, aromatic scent while being worked, while freshly cut cypress has a somewhat sour odor.
